Although it appears to have been repainted...this fiberglass bear is clearly Yogi Bear from the Hanna-Barbera cartoons. He made his debut in 1958. This statue has the green tie and hat that Yogi wore..and the stiff shirt collar (but no shirt!). He was created by William Hanna, Joseph Barbera and Ed Benedict. He was so popular that he got his own cartoon TV show in 1961. He was almost always paired with his friend Boo-BOO (also a bear). He was also a feature or star in a few animated movies. His catch phrase was "I'm smarter than the average bear!".
